What Are The Hot Landscaping And Outdoor Living Space Trends For 2021?

Thanks to the COVID-19 pandemic, our homes are much more than a simple place to lay our heads at night. They need to be highly multifunctional to accommodate a broad range of work and play activities. With an increase in the at-home presence and an almost desperate need for fresh air, it is no surprise that customized outdoor living spaces are trending in 2021. According to the National Kitchen & Bath Association, there has been a 65 percent increase in interest for general outdoor living projects.


Having an outdoor living space that meets your recreational needs is becoming more valuable than ever before. Ninety percent of Americans are taking greater advantage of their decks, porches, and patios. While backyards tend to be the primary focus for shiny upgrades, people are also granting attention to their front and side yards, as they enable neighborly interaction and foster a much-needed sense of community. With summer 2021 right around the corner, it is the perfect time to upgrade your outdoor living space so you can enjoy the comforts of summer vacation without the inconvenience of travel.


Daily Functioning

Backyards and porches aren’t just for entertaining guests anymore. More and more people create outdoor living setups that facilitate everyday life, from private spaces for exercise or yoga to practical offices for work-from-home situations. The border between indoor and outdoor is becoming more blurred as homeowners replicate or move elements from their living rooms and kitchens outside. Outdoor furniture needs to be comfort worthy of an afternoon of relaxed lounging and luxury. Many pieces are also convertible, saving space while still allowing for greater accommodation.


Among the most requested features are expanded or upgraded seating that is safe for social distancing, weather-proof furniture capable of withstanding the elements, and classic fireplaces and fire pits. Outdoor kitchens are another popular project, desired by an astounding 60 percent of homeowners. And we aren’t just talking about a backyard grill and picnic table. In 2021, outdoor kitchens come with every appliance imaginable, from sinks, storage, and prep spaces to refrigeration and pizza ovens. It’s enough to make any chef blush.


Outdoor spaces are also being adjusted to accommodate “true living.” Pergolas are immensely popular for providing essential shade for long hours spent under the sun, and backyard cottages can accommodate visiting relatives or friends in need of a temporary home. Single room backyard offices are also great for separating your workspace from your living space without commuting.


Natural Emphasis And Appreciation

Creating a backyard garden with edible or native plants is an excellent way to upgrade your outdoor living space to benefit your health and quality of life substantially. Research shows that daily contact with nature can have a positive and long-lasting impact to your physical and mental well-being. It has even been recognized as a cost-effective health intervention and treatment strategy. For example, horticultural therapy can reduce stress as well as symptoms of depression and anxiety. Moreover, gardening is beneficial for the environment, especially if you use native plants and composting. In San Francisco, composting measures reduced the amount of trash sent to landfills by 80 percent.


Gardening was one of the only industries to benefit from the pandemic and consequential isolation policies. A global data survey found that gardening was the second most popular lockdown activity right after watching television. The retail industry experienced an 8.79 percent revenue increase in 2020 despite sales in other sectors taking a huge hit. Installing sustainable garden features is a modern way to increase the value of your home.


Embracing Smart Technology

Entertainment features previously enjoyed in our living rooms and basements are now being brought outside, and outdoor living spaces are becoming more technologically advanced and integrated. Many homeowners are investing in Wi-Fi systems and electrical outlets to watch movies, T.V. shows, and other streaming services outside. Similarly, Bluetooth-capable speakers are gaining popularity, and customization options are plentiful. Speakers can be disguised as rocks or stones or even implemented inside planters to blend seamlessly with the landscape design.


Smart lighting is another trending feature that is essential for enjoying outdoor spaces. Uplights and downlights can highlight the aesthetic qualities of your home while also increasing functionality. With intelligent lighting control, you can utilize timers and motion sensors to maximize energy savings and property security.
